Another Habitation Certificate Question

Hi Everyone,

We have been looking through a lot of posts in this section and are a bit confused. We recently completed buying a villa and have the tapu. ( The Kat Irtifaki box has been ticked ). Today we contacted the builder about the habitation certificate - which he says he has, and needed it to connect the electric and water to the villa which was done in May. He says he will give us the certificate when we see him again.

Our question is do we need to get a new certificate under our names or does the certificate cover the building and is passed on whenever the property is sold. The builder says we can get the electric and water put in our names when we go back over. Not sure about why the tapu has got Kat Irtifaki box ticked though, when the builder had the tapu in his name before the transfer it had the Kat Muliyeti box ticked.

Re: Another Habitation Certificate Question

It sounds as it the Habitation certificate was not issued when the Tapu was issued, I don't think you need your name on the habitation certificate as it's for the building and not the owner.

Re: Another Habitation Certificate Question

The habitation certificate is issued on the finish of a property, it is an inspection of the finished property to see that it has been built to plan and the electric and water are done to a certain standard, then they issue the Habitation Certificate.

Did your builder finish the house a year ago, because if not the Tapu he had that you saw was when he bought the land.

My builder gave me a copy of his Tapu for the land along with a copy of his ID card when we signed the contract for our house, that was just to prove he owned the land our house was built on.

Hi,
I think it cost me something like 90 lira to change the water to my name. Be careful though, as when the Beledeiye done mine they took my reading back to nought. Only just really found out after scouring over all the paperwork. The next bill after this was all done i realised too late that i had paid all over again! TIT springs to mind! This is Turkey.
As for electricity, that hasnt been done yet as the site is still on sahsi electric supply waiting to be transferred over to Tedas. That will be fun then!

Cheers
Lorraine
BTW that was for Davutlar, Kusadasi so may vary from area to area
